http://blcwebcafe.org/pouch WebSep 22, 2016 · The surgeon connects the pouch to the skin in the abdomen and a stoma is created. An Indiana pouch does not use an external pouch to collect the urine; instead, patients must learn to drain the internal pouch periodically by inserting a catheter through the stoma. This is known as … WebApr 9, 2024 · Creation of Indiana Pouch A patient underwent a simple cystectomy with creation of an Indiana pouch. During the procedure, dissection of the bladder was carried out. The ascending colon and ileum were divided and sutured creating a pouch, and the bowel was reanastomosed.
